What is the significance of the color blue in Chefchaouen?

Symbolism of Blue

In Chefchaouen, the color blue holds cultural and spiritual significance. It is not merely a choice of color for aesthetics but a representation of various aspects of life in the city. The blue color is deeply rooted in the history of Chefchaouen, signifying peace, spirituality, and tradition.

Cultural Identity

The blue color of Chefchaouen's streets reflects the city's unique identity and cultural heritage. It symbolizes the unity of the community and their collective history. The residents take pride in preserving the tradition of painting everything blue, showcasing their distinct cultural identity to the world.

Spiritual Connection

For many residents of Chefchaouen, the color blue is associated with spirituality and divine protection. It is believed to ward off evil spirits and bring blessings to the inhabitants. The constant presence of the blue hue reinforces a spiritual connection within the community.

Symbol of Peace

Blue is often associated with peace and tranquility. In Chefchaouen, the abundance of blue creates a peaceful atmosphere, promoting harmony and a sense of calm among residents and visitors alike. The color blue in Chefchaouen serves as a symbol of peace in a bustling city.
